So you're moving the Tindercap build onto our hermetic build system — welcome. First thing that breaks is anything reading from the network at build time; vendor those deps into the lockfile instead. Second gotcha: the old scripts assumed a writable home directory, which the sandbox denies. Check the migration checklist before filing issues. To fetch the prebuilt toolchain bundle from the internal cache, the bootstrap step wants this credential.

session JWT of yawep-yawep = eyJhbGciOiJIUzI1NiIsInR5cCI6IkpXVCJ9.eyJzdWIiOiI3pWF3_In0.aXYsHiog

Handover — Marla to Devek, dispatch desk. The replacement lock for the Varnholt office safe arrived this morning from Kessler Lockworks, double-boxed and seal intact (seal number logged in the intake ledger). Do not open the inner carton; the fitting team at Branview will verify it on arrival. The courier from Ostrell Freight is booked for the 14:20 slot and will ask for the dispatch supervisor by name. Before release, confirm the following hand-over instruction has been followed exactly.

handover note for kagep-kagup: the holok holdor courier leaves the rusix sorox fenwyn ledger at gate 3590 under passcode 092644

Welcome to on-call for the Glimmerpane design system! Our snapshot tests live in the `snapcheck` suite and run on every merge to main. If a UI component changes visually, the diff bot flags it — usually it's an intentional tweak, so just approve the new baseline. If it's 2am and snapshots are failing across the board, it's almost always a font-loading race, not your problem. To unlock the baseline store and re-approve snapshots in bulk, use the recovery passphrase below.

recovery phrase for tahag-taguf: wenix-caswyn

## Deployment: Cold Starts

The Quillmere handlers run on a serverless runtime, and cold starts remain our main latency risk. Each handler lazily initialises the template cache and the Fenwick routing table, which together add roughly two seconds on a fresh instance. We keep one warm instance per region and pre-warm before the Tuesday batch window. Tune these knobs conservatively; overly aggressive concurrency limits re-trigger cold starts. The current production settings are as follows.

config for kajog-tadug:
[casax]
port = 11211
region = west-3
host = casax.nelvroworks.internal
timeout_ms = 5000
retries = 7